Public service design

Engine works with organisations to plan and run creative and collaborative projects to inform policy making and design better services.

We work with some great organisations including the NHS, local authorities, Government departments, NGOs, universities and charities; involving users, staff, managers and other experts in service design and co-production. We are a diverse team of designers, strategists, researchers and facilitators, able to work sensitively to help define the problem, understand the needs and co-create solutions.
